Job Description

We are seeking a detail-oriented and analytical Security and ICT Inspector to join our organization in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. In this role, you will be responsible for reviewing the Design, implementing, and maintaining secure information and communication technology infrastructure. You will work to protect our Project's critical systems and data while ensuring compliance with industry security standards and regulations. The successful candidate will demonstrate strong technical supervision capabilities, organized problem-solving abilities, and a commitment to maintaining the highest security standards.

  • Review Design, shop drawings, Material Submittals submitted by Contractors, implement, and maintain secure ICT infrastructure and network systems of the Project.
  • Liaise with Client teams to Conduct comprehensive security vulnerability assessments and penetration testing to identify potential risks
  • Liaise with Client to Develop and enforce security policies, procedures, and protocols aligned with industry standards
  • Monitor network traffic and system logs to detect and respond to security incidents
  • Perform regular security inspections and audits and ensure compliance with relevant regulations and frameworks and Client's Requirements
  • Troubleshoot and resolve ICT and security-related issues in a timely and efficient manner
  • Collaborate with IT teams to implement security patches, updates, and system improvements
  • Document security configurations, incidents, and remediation actions for audit and compliance purposes
  • Stay current with emerging security threats and recommend preventive measures
  • Provide technical support and guidance to end-users regarding security best practices
